We decided to empirically research the information privacy of mental health apps. Our empirical investigation shows a excessive prevalence of information disclosure threats, primarily originating from insecure programming. Threats associated to linkability, identifiability, non-repudiation and detectability are also exacerbated by the large number of 3rd-parties in the apps’ ecosystem, facilitating profiling of customers and exploitative advertising. Apps additionally lack transparency and adequate notice mechanisms, resulting in unawareness and non-compliance threats.

Are mental health records protected under HIPAA?

HIPAA provides a personal representative of a patient with the same rights to access health information as the patient, including the right to request a complete medical record containing mental health information. The patient's right of access has some exceptions, which would also apply to a personal representative.

For occasion, privacy considerations were greater for patients’ social interplay, self-reported, and biometric data. Users were less concerned about privateness points throughout data collection in comparability with the information transmission and sharing levels. These events had adverse impacts on the continual intention to make use of mHealth apps [39]. Ermakova et al [42] additionally discovered that patients’ acceptance of well being clouds for nonsensitive medical knowledge was not significantly affected by confidentiality assurance; nonetheless, this relationship was important for sensitive medical data. Natsiavas et al [26] discovered that 12% of patients in their study have been unaware of the potential for health data dangers, whereas a higher share of individuals (61%) within the study by Özkan et al [28] didn't know who had the right to access their medical records. Thematic evaluation of the information gathered by Bauer et al [32] revealed that sufferers opted for a better understanding of different events who've access to their well being information and their capacity to manage such entry.

Political disinformation campaigns have focused individuals whose profiles embody particular traits related to mental health, corresponding to melancholy, Caltrider stated. In addition, she said, well being insurers purchase info from knowledge brokers that might have an effect on the premiums charged in communities with greater instances of mental well being points. Knowledge brokers are, in reality, collecting and selling mental well being knowledge, according to a report launched final month by Duke College.
